Polyfill in slot ported box

 

Anonymous
 
can polyfill be placed inside a slot ported box?
will it affect the tuning of the box any?

Yeah, I think it should make it a lower tune. I think it's something like a lb of poly fill per fubic foot makes the box seem 10% larger. Larger the box with the same size ports, lower tune. I could be wrong though.

if it's ported, you are going to need to buy the polyfill that is in sheets. then staple them to the sides. if you just put in plain stuffy polyfill, it's gonna be blowing out of your ports.

Ive seen on many occasions where it is recommended to put polifill in ported boxes the only thing is that you need to staple chicken wire of some sort just before the port begins to shoot straight out to hold the polifill in place and it should sound a little better "SO I HEAR!"
